We played the dirty nappy game, what a scream, great for pictures. You need six nappies, and six different types of chocolates, melt them into the nappies and then let your guests open and see if they can work out what's in them, the looks on their faces are priceless, check out these pics.....some even get brave enough to eat it!!!!
